Earn One SkyMile for virtually every other dollar you spend.
- APR: Prime + 9.99%, currently 13.99%
- Balance Transfer APR: 9.99% fixed for the life of the balance, for balance transfers made during the first six months of membership.
- Annual fee: $85 for Basic Cardholder and up to two additional cards unless you are also the Basic Cardmember for a Qualifying Business Charge Card Product, in which case the annual fee is $30 for the Basic Card and up to two additional cards.
Additional Gold Delta SkyMiles Business Credit Card Benefits
- Your SkyMiles Number printed on your Card
- Always Double Miles® - When you use your Card at supermarkets, drugstores, gas stations, home improvement and hardware stores, the U.S. Postal Service, on Delta or Song purchases and your wireless phone bill payments.

Establish good credit with specialty cards Before you dive into that sack of mail to collect the many credit cards approved for you, consider starting small by applying for cards for practical purposes. Obtaining a credit card for a major department store or gas station is a good way to establish credit while curbing bad spending habits. Some cards may require you to pay the monthly balance in full when it is due, so this way you have the opportunity to prove that you can be a controlled spender and be responsible for monthly bills. Secured Credit Cards One way people get into trouble with credit cards is overspending. Limits may be set, but it is possible to run too many charges on a card so that the monthly minimum payment becomes too much to handle. Add that you continue to spend as you pay off, and the balance will never decrease! A secured credit cards is similar to a debit card, in that a set amount of cash from your bank account is placed in your spending queue. As you buy things, the money is deducted. All you have to do is keep track. Proper use of a secured credit card can train you well for a regular credit card with a larger spending limit. Don't think because you have a card with a ten thousand dollar limit, it means you have to spend the money. Eventually, you will have to pay it back! Controlled spending, wise investments, practice with limited store credit cards and responsible money management all contribute to building good credit. Debt is a stressful thing for many people - some can get things under control themselves while others need assistance. For many people, one of the most effective ways of getting their debt under control is to use a debt consolidation loan. Fortunately, over the last several years, finding one of these loans has become much easier thanks to the internet. All the tools you need to find a loan are available to you on the internet. There are lots of websites where you can research loans, and even more general information about getting debt under control. You can compare loans from various sources to find the best interest rate and most effective terms. Once you find the best deal, you can usually apply for a loan directly on their website. You'll need to have all the necessary personal information handy - basically the same as you would need if applying at your bank or somewhere else in person. You'll need all your debt accounts - credit cards, department store accounts, etc. - and the current balance on each. You'll also need your employment details and possibly information about the security you can use for the loan, such as your home or vehicles. In most cases, you will have a response very quickly. Once you've been approved for a debt consolidation loan, the load provider will pay off each of your debt on your behalf. This leaves you with a single payment and a single loan to deal with, instead of many different ones. This single loan normally has a much lower interest rate than all the other ones (especially credit cards) and it is easier to manage a single payment every month. Before you make your decision on which loan company you want to use, call their customer service department and ask a few questions. Make sure their customer service is easy to reach and knowledgable about their services. You don't want to find out they aren't very helpful after you've already signed up with them.
